当前位置:首页 > 广场 > Maven配置:仓库、打包参数与环境设置详解

Maven配置:仓库、打包参数与环境设置详解

admin8个月前 (08-24)广场75

Maven配置:仓库、打包参数与环境设置详解

在现代软件开发中,Maven作为一种强大的项目管理工具,被广泛应用于Java项目的构建和依赖管理。为了充分利用Maven的功能,合理配置仓库、打包参数以及环境是至关重要的。本文将详细介绍如何进行这些配置,以帮助开发者更高效地使用Maven。

一、Maven仓库配置

Maven配置:仓库、打包参数与环境设置详解

Maven仓库是存储项目依赖项的重要地方。在pom.xml文件中,我们可以通过添加元素来指定所需的仓库。例如,可以使用以下代码来添加中央仓库:

<repositories>    <repository>        <id>中央仓库</id>        <url>https://repo1.maven.org/maven2</url>    </repository></repositories>

通过这种方式,开发者可以确保所需的依赖项能够从指定的位置获取,从而避免了因网络问题导致构建失败的问题。【燎元跃动小编】建议在实际操作中根据需要选择合适的镜像或私有仓库,以提高下载速度和稳定性。

二、打包参数配置

Maven允许用户自定义打包过程,通过在pom.xml文件中的元素下添加相关插件,可以实现对Java版本及目标版本的设置。例如,以下代码将Java编译器版本设置为1.8:

<build>    <plugins>        <plugin>            <groupId>org.apache.maven.plugins</groupId>            <artifactId&mgt;maven-compiler-plugin</artifactId&gt;&            ltversion>t3.8.1</version>t            <duration: 0ptarget/gtt                >>    0ptarget/gtt                                     >>

This configuration ensures that the project is compiled with Java version 1.8, which is crucial for maintaining compatibility with various libraries and frameworks.【燎元跃动小编】提醒大家,在选择Java版本时,要考虑到团队成员及生产环境的一致性。

三、环境配置

A proper environment setup is essential for using Maven effectively. First, ensure that both the Java Development Kit (JDK) and Maven are installed on your system.

  • Create an environment variable named M2_HOME and set its value to your Maven installation directory.
  • Add %M2_HOME%\bin to the PATH variable so you can run Maven commands from any command line interface.

This configuration allows developers to execute `mvn` commands seamlessly, enhancing productivity during development cycles.

{燎元跃动小编}

以上就是关于“Maven 配置: 仓库 、 打包 参数 和 环境 设置”的详细内容,希望能为广大开发者提供实用的信息。更多相关内容,请关注我们的后续更新!

热点关注:

Maven是什么?

Maven是一种用于管理Java项目构建和依赖关系的软件工具,它简化了项目管理流程,提高了效率。

Mave如何处理依赖?

Mave通过定义pom.xml文件中的dependencies部分来处理各种外部组件和类库,使得项目可以自动下载并集成这些资源。

版权声明:本文由燎元跃动发布,如需转载请注明出处。

本文链接:https://www.cnicic.com/square/2781.html

分享给朋友:

“Maven配置:仓库、打包参数与环境设置详解” 的相关文章

学信网账号登录的详细步骤

学信网账号登录的详细步骤

学信网账号登录的详细步骤在现代社会,学信网作为中国高等教育学生信息网,为广大学生提供了重要的服务,包括学历查询、成绩管理等。为了顺利使用这些功能,了解如何登录学信网账号至关重要。本文将为您详细介绍学信网账号登录的步骤及常见问题解答。如何登录学信网账号要成功登录您的学信网账号,请按照以下步骤操作:...

学信网注册详细指南

学信网注册详细指南

学信网注册详细指南在现代社会,学信网作为一个重要的教育信息服务平台,为学生和毕业生提供了诸多便利。为了顺利使用该平台,了解学信网的注册流程显得尤为重要。本文将为您详细介绍如何在学信网上进行注册,包括实名认证和手机号注册两种方式,让您轻松上手。一、学信网注册方式概述学信网提供两种主要的注册方式:实名认...

学信网如何查询他人学历的合法途径

学信网如何查询他人学历的合法途径

学信网如何查询他人学历的合法途径在当今社会,学历信息成为了个人求职、升学的重要参考依据。然而,许多人可能会遇到想要查询他人学历的需求,但却不知道该如何合法地进行。这时,了解学信网及其相关规定显得尤为重要。本文将深入探讨通过学信网查询他人学历的合法途径,以及一些注意事项。什么是学信网?中国高等教育学生...

XSS检测工具的全面解析

XSS检测工具的全面解析

XSS检测工具的全面解析XSS(跨站脚本攻击)是一种常见且严重的网络安全漏洞,允许攻击者在用户浏览器中执行恶意脚本,从而窃取敏感信息或进行其他恶意操作。为了有效防范XSS攻击,使用合适的检测工具至关重要。本文将深入探讨各种XSS检测工具,包括在线和本地解决方案,以帮助用户选择最适合他们需求的工具。【...

VSCode中最佳主题推荐与选择指南

VSCode中最佳主题推荐与选择指南

VSCode中最佳主题推荐与选择指南在当今编程环境中,Visual Studio Code(VSCode)因其强大的功能和灵活的自定义选项而备受欢迎。尤其是主题的选择,不仅影响到代码的可读性,还直接关系到开发者的工作效率和舒适度。本文将深入探讨VSCode中的一些最佳主题,以及如何根据个人需求进行选...

如何查看 Nginx 版本

如何查看 Nginx 版本

如何查看 Nginx 版本Nginx 是一款轻量级且高性能的 Web 服务器,广泛应用于各类网站和应用程序。了解您当前使用的 Nginx 版本对于解决问题、进行升级或安装附加模块至关重要。本文将详细介绍两种查看 Nginx 版本的方法,帮助您快速获取所需信息。方法一:通过命令行查看 Nginx 版本...